Melee damage occurs to any unit caught in a melee weapon attack.Damage is dealt based on proximity, and individual body sections do not alter damage received. Explosive damage occurs with any target caught in a blast radius.Depending on the region of the body / vehicle struck, a projectile may deal variable damage. Direct damage occurs with any projectile striking a footman or vehicle.All weapons deal in 3 different types of health damage, sometimes in 2 at once:.When a weapon knocks an infantry unit's balance down to 0, the unit will trip and fall. All weapons deal damage to infantry in 2 areas: damage to health and damage to balance.Firing a weapon while prone will sharply decrease its recoil.Īmmunition for weapons may be collected from Resupply Crates, Ammo Bags, or by kicking a bot's corpse and collecting the disgorged ammo crate. With the notable exception of a few pieces of equipment, all weapons share the same control schemes and general functionality: aim, zoom, fire/use, reload, resupply. However, in the key area of video recording, Betacam and Betamax use completely different on-tape formats. Betacam and Betamax are similar in some ways- early versions of Betacam used the same video cassette shape, used the same oxide tape formulation with the same coercivity, and recorded linear audio tracks in the same location of the tape. Released in 1982, Betacam became the most widely used videotape format in ENG (electronic news gathering), replacing the. The early-form Betacam tapes (left) are interchangeable with Betamax (right), though the recordings are not.įor the professional and broadcast video industry, Sony derived Betacam from Betamax. The arrival of Betacam reduced the demand for both industrial Beta and U-Matic equipment. These were aimed at the same market as U-Matic equipment, but were cheaper and smaller. Sony also offered a range of industrial Betamax products, a Beta I-only format for industrial and institutional users. Initially, Sony was able to tout several Betamax-only features, such as BetaScan-a high-speed picture search in either direction-and BetaSkipScan, a technique that allowed the operator to see where they were on the tape by pressing the FF key (or REW, if in that mode): the transport would switch into the BetaScan mode until the key was released. The SL-8200 was to compete against the VHS VCRs, which allowed up to 4, and later 6 and 8, hours of recording on one cassette. This VCR had two recording speeds: normal, and the newer half speed. In 1977, Sony issued the first long-play Betamax VCR, the SL-8200. The suffix -max, from the word "maximum", was added to suggest greatness. According to Sony's history webpages, the name had a double meaning: beta is the Japanese word used to describe the way in which signals are recorded on the tape and the shape of the lowercase Greek letter beta (β) resembles the course of the tape through the transport. Like the rival videotape format VHS (introduced in Japan by JVC in September 1976 and in the United States by RCA in August 1977), Betamax has no guard band and uses azimuth recording to reduce crosstalk. The cassettes contain 0.50-inch-wide (12.7 mm) videotape in a design similar to that of the earlier, professional 0.75-inch-wide (19 mm), U-matic format.
